Burn-9

 

There are a whole lot of Metal Gear Solid-inspired video games – even director Hideo Kojima borrows closely from it in his post-MGS tasks like Death Stranding and Physint. But often, these video games put you accountable for the Snake parallel. Burn-9, nonetheless, has caught my curiosity by being a MGS-inspired sport that doesn’t try this; as a substitute, you play because the individual within the chair, because it have been. Described by developer 14 Hours Productions as a “Tactical Radio Action” sport, one other nod to MGS’s “Tactical Espionage Action” tag, in Burn-9, your job is to information the final survivor of an elite black-ops staff after a mission has gone terribly incorrect. 

“When a top secret military research facility in the Antarctic goes dark, an elite strike force of cybernetically-enhanced black-ops super soldiers is dispatched to investigate and secure Burn-9 at all costs,” the sport’s description reads. “Minutes into the mission, the helicopter is shot down. There is one survivor… and you’re her only lifeline.” As the staff’s Operator, you will want to information her to security whereas navigating the stress and calls for of the highest brass and the tough actuality on the bottom. What you share, what you maintain again, and who you belief is as much as you. On prime of that distinctive premise, Burn-9 launches this yr on PC. 

Castlevania: Belmont’s Curse

 

Evil Empire made a reputation for itself engaged on Dead Cells, a sport closely impressed by Castlevania. Then, it made a fair stronger impression with Dead Cells’ Castlevania DLC. With such basic love for the vampire-hunting sequence, the studio looks like the right option to helm the primary correct Castlevania sport in years, so once we noticed it was the staff behind the upcoming Castlevania: Belmont’s Curse, it nearly appeared too good to be true.

And but, the sport is actual, and appears pretty much as good as you’d count on. We see our new protagonist, Rose Belmont, wield a whip or sword and protect to destroy supernatural minions, harness magic to parry assaults and break by means of obstacles, and use a map to discover her environment, identical to the handfuls of indie video games the sequence has impressed. The bosses on this trailer additionally look terrifying and completely designed. The artwork path, typically, is an efficient search for the franchise – colourful sufficient to be attention-grabbing, but darkish, placing, and unmistakably gothic. It appears to be like superior, and it will be out on October 15.

Clockwork Revolution

 

The builders at inXile have years of expertise crafting narrative-forward video games with plenty of selection layered in, however Clockwork Revolution seems to be an particularly bold endeavor. Players navigate by means of the fictional steampunk metropolis of Avalon, confronting challenges in any variety of distinctive methods to achieve their goals. 

While immersive role-playing experiences like this are sometimes compelling with out extra twists, Clockwork Revolution layers in a slick time-travel mechanic that lets gamers transfer forwards and backwards by means of time. Make adjustments to town many years earlier, and the outcomes grow to be obvious whenever you journey again to the current. 

Clockwork Revolution is one among a small handful of video games that see Xbox pulling again on its cross-compatibility method from latest years; inXile’s new RPG might be an Xbox console unique. It’s one we’re watching with nice curiosity within the lead-up to a 2027 launch.

Final Fantasy VII Revelation

 

Roughly a decade in the past, the thought of a Final Fantasy VII Remake, whereas technically actual, appeared unattainable. Now, years and years later, we’re lower than a yr away from the finale, Final Fantasy VII Revelation, and we nonetheless form of can’t consider Square Enix has pulled this off. As the shock nearer of the annual Summer Game Fest showcase, Square Enix not solely revealed Revelation, however gave us a on-stage deep-dive into what we will count on within the finale sequel. 

Cid’s Highwind is within the sport, giving gamers the flexibility to freely fly across the planet and Fortnite-style drop onto the bottom under; Cid is playable, a dragoon at coronary heart, and so is Vincent Valentine (and you may change between beast and human mode everytime you need); what’s principally a Job system has been added within the type of outfits that rework the brawler Tifa right into a Black Mage, for instance; and Sephiroth has a brand new voice actor within the type of Travis Willingham. Perhaps extra thrilling than all of that, Queen’s Blood, the unimaginable card sport from Final Fantasy VII Rebirth, is again, this time with celebration member Red XIII because the protagonist. 

There is a lot to be enthusiastic about in Final Fantasy VII Revelation, and the truth that it’s launching worldwide concurrently on P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, Nintendo Switch 2, and PC – that means no person must wait a yr for a port on their platform of selection whereas dodging spoilers – subsequent Spring is the cherry-red materia on prime.

Gears of War: E-Day

 

Gears of War: E-Day is coming dwelling (after a really transient multiplatform tour that noticed the latest remake of the primary sport, Gears of War Reloaded, come to PlayStation 5). Despite hypothesis that E-Day would hit Sony’s console, Xbox revealed throughout its latest showcase that it’s, the truth is, an Xbox Series X/S console unique, which is to say it’s launching on Xbox and PC on October 6. It nonetheless retains the basic third-person cowl shooter DNA in each mainline Gears entry earlier than it, however E-Day is unquestionably extra bloody and violent, and developer The Coalition is including new motion mechanics that translate to a extra dynamic expertise total. 

Set 14 years earlier than the occasions of the primary Gears sport, E-Day chronicles the occasions of Emergence Day, or, in Gears historical past, the day the enemy Locust hordes erupted from the bottom under to put siege on humanity. E-Day takes place within the shellshocked metropolis of Kalona and stars unique protagonist Marcus Fenix alongside Dom, a few different acquainted faces, and some new ones, too. The Coalition says E-Days’ story explores themes of burden, loss, and loyalty, and the marketing campaign is performed from the angle of the brand new Bravo Squad: Marcus, Dom, Carter, a brand new Gear, and Lucas, a recent cadet who by no means anticipated to be on the entrance strains. They should navigate wartime tensions and interpersonal relationships whereas making an attempt to cease the Locust horde from destroying town they love, and so they’ll accomplish that in a marketing campaign that guarantees 4K decision, 60 FPS gameplay, and hardware-based ray-tracing. 

And in multiplayer, which returns with on-line classics and a brand new 12-player Horde Raid, you’ll be able to count on 120 FPS motion. This is a chunk of Gears historical past that followers have lengthy speculated on, and it’s thrilling understanding we’re just some months away from studying the place humanity’s warfare in opposition to the Locusts started. 

Gen Atlas

 

The anticipate the following sport from the creator of Ico, Shadow of the Colossus, and The Last Guardian has been lengthy. Fumito Ueda’s final sport was launched in 2016, and even that was after substantial delays. Ueda likes to take his time, however so far, the wait has all the time been worthwhile. No one makes video games so stuffed with intrigue, loneliness, scale, and emotion fairly like Ueda and his staff.

Cryptically teased in 2024 with the non permanent identify Project Robot, through the major Summer Game Fest showcase this yr, Gen Atlas was formally unveiled. We now have not less than some thought of how the sport works: a humanoid protagonist drives round a large, flying robotic head, which they will connect to seemingly deserted big robots to take management of them. In our interview with Ueda after seeing the sport, he mentioned, “The robot head is going to be many things to the player character. At times, it will be a means of transportation, like a vehicle. At times, it will be your navigator. At times, it is more functional to use it as a tool. But it’s also going to be your partner, as well. So it doesn’t just serve one thing. It’s going to serve multiple sorts of roles.” You even have a gun, which we have now positively by no means seen in a Ueda sport.

We nonetheless have a whole lot of questions on Gen Atlas. Is it a sequel to Ueda’s earlier three video games (he implies that he doesn’t actually know, however we’re skeptical)? Who is the protagonist? What occurred to this world? Frankly, we don’t really need to know earlier than we have now an opportunity to play the ultimate sport, but it surely’s thrilling to theorize. We sit up for interested by Gen Atlas for years to return after taking part in, simply as we have now for all his earlier adventures.

Resident Evil Veronica

 

Capcom has discovered a great launch cadence for arguably its most profitable franchise. New sport, remake, new sport, remake, and so forth. We knew a remake was up subsequent after having a good time with Resident Evil Requiem earlier this yr, however we didn’t know what was coming. Rumors and theories pointed to a different remake of the unique Resident Evil or following the trail of two remake, 3, remake, and 4 remake, it appeared like 5 was up subsequent. We have been delighted, nonetheless, when it was revealed that Code Veronica can be the following sport to get the remedy.

Arguably an important however least-played mainline Resident Evil, Code Veronica was supposed to be a numbered Resident Evil sport throughout improvement, particularly 3. But enterprise choices and pessimism concerning the unique launch being a Dreamcast-exclusive led Capcom to provide Nemesis (initially meant to be a smaller spinoff) a correct quantity, whereas Code Veronica acquired a non-numbered subtitle. As a end result, it was inadvertently handled as a by-product, regardless of starring Claire Redfield and exploring the vital historical past of the founders of the evil Umbrella Corporation.

All of that’s to say that it’s arguably the Resident Evil most deserving of a revisit. It will fill in vital story gaps many could have missed, and it’s an opportunity to spend extra time with Claire, who hasn’t reappeared for the reason that Resident Evil 2 remake.

Star Trek: Shadow Frontier

 

The great factor concerning the Star Trek franchise is that it’s malleable when it comes to style. It can principally be no matter it must be in an effort to inform a narrative concerning the shut relationships that develop throughout alien species whereas residing on spaceships. When the trailer for Shadow Frontier started making it clear it was a horror sport, we weren’t positive if that’s what we needed from a Star Trek sport (regardless that loads of episodes have dabbled within the style), however when Ro Laren appeared as the sport’s obvious protagonist, we have been firmly on board.

For these unaware, Ro Laren was a preferred character who appeared in later seasons of The Next Generation. She was brash and significant of Starfleet and an important opinionated foil to Captain Picard. She was so fashionable, the truth is, that early variations of Deep Space Nine have been constructed round Ro (and her performer, Michelle Forbes) earlier than they pivoted to creating an unique character, Kira. She was a personality that all the time deserved extra (and her transient look in Picard solely left us unfulfilled), so to see her (and Forbes) main this new sport is thrilling.

Add to that Bloober’s upward development of high quality with video games like Cronos: The New Dawn and the Silent Hill 2 remake, and we’re excited to see what it does within the Star Trek universe with a beloved character.
